Tucows to buy NetIdentity

Tucows will pay $18M for NetIdentity.

World well known domain wholesaler Tucows announced on Friday it has entered into an agreement to acquire Mailbank, aka NetIdentity - a privately held company that operates a large porfolio of domain names.


Tucows will pay approximately $18 million in cash, promissory notes and the issue of approximately 3,603,000 shares of common stock to the stockholders of NetIdentity. Tucows expects this acquisition to add between $3 and $4 million in cash flow in 2007. It now expects cash flow from operations to be in the range of $7 million to $8 million for 2006 and $10 million to $12 million for 2007.


The acquisition will enable Tucows to offer personalized Internet services through its channel of over 6,000 resellers. The portfolio includes thousands of the most common surnames and will be used to enhance Tucows’ email, Web publishing and domain services.
